Overview of Arkansas Elementary School

Arkansas Elementary School is a public school situated in Aurora, CO, which is in a large city environment. The learner population of Arkansas Elementary School is 411, and the school has PK-5. At Arkansas Elementary School, 13% of learners scored above or at the proficient level for math, and 27% scored above or at that level for reading.

The school’s minority learner enrollment is 77%. The learner-teacher ratio is 16:1, which is better than that of the district.

The learner population is made up of 48% female learners and 52% male learners. The school enrolls 73% of low-income learners. There are 25 equivalent full-time teachers and 1 full-time school counselor.

Test Scores at Arkansas Elementary School

At Arkansas Elementary School, 13% of learners scored above or at the proficient level for math, and 27% scored above or at that level for reading.

Juxtaposed with the district, the school did worse in math and better in reading, according to this measure. In Aurora Joint District No. 28 Of The Counties Of Adams And A, 25% of learners tested above or at the proficient level for reading, and 17% tested above or at that level for math.

Arkansas Elementary School did worse in math and worse in reading in this measure juxtaposed with learners across the state. In Colorado, 42% of learners tested above or at the proficient level for reading, and 33% tested above or at that level for math.
